Job Title: Sr. Analog Design Engineer
Job Duties:
- Conduct design and development of image sensor technologies in advanced sub-micron node, including finfet, work on transistor level design of analog and mixed-signal circuits for CMOS Image Sensor such as asic_pixel array, column-bias generation, rampbuffer, column-amplifier, comparator, ramp generator, ASRAM and XDEC by using Cadence Virtuoso.
- Work on analog and mixed signal circuits layout design by Cadence Layout tool, such as column_array.
- Collaborate with layout engineer on whole chip layout integration, verification, and improvement.
- Perform sub-blocks and whole image sensor readout circuit simulation (DCG function, noise, PSRR, H-banding, etc.) by simulators such as Cadence Spectre, Analog FastSPICE (AFS), Empyrean ALPS and NanoSpice.
- Perform design verification such as DRC, LVS, antenna rule, and PERC check by using Siemens Caliber tools.
- Extract post-layout parasitic parameters by Calibre PEX.
- Process simulation data and develop script for test bench.
- Collaborate with Digital Engineer to define and design the analog to digital interface and timing generation.
- Collaborate with verification, process, test, and application engineers to debug, characterize and optimize performance of fabricated image sensors.
- Propose innovative and creative solutions along with new circuit R&D and be ahead of current technology.
